Mersacidin, a new antibiotic from Bacillus Fermentation, isolation, purification and chemical characterization.

Abstract: Mersacidin (1) is a new peptide antibiotic containing /?-methyllanthionine. It is classified as a memberof the proposed lantibiotic group of antibiotics, and is produced by a species of Bacillus. Mersacidin has a molecular weight of 1,824 (C80H120N20O21S4). The antibiotic is active against Gram-positive organisms including meth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us, but has no activity against Gram-negative bacteria or fungi.
